SUMMARY OF POSITION:

The Nursing Professional Development Practitioner supports the quality of care provided to patients by Department of Nursing staff through optimal orientation programs, ongoing evaluation of competence, and support of lifelong learning. The Nursing Professional Development Practitioner promotes relevant professional development opportunities and mentorship for members of the department of nursing at all levels to assist with the achievement of personal and professional goals. The Nursing Professional Development Practitioner will identify outcomes of educational interventions based on input from learners and stakeholders, evidence, regulations and organizational goals.This role supports both, Hampden and Holy Spirit, medical centers and the transfer of physical training materials to multiple PSH locations.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ATION(S):

  • MSN or intent to complete MSN within three (3) years of hire.
  • Bachelor's of Science in Nursing required.
  • Three (3) years nursing experience.
  • Currently licensed to practice as a Registered Nurse by state of employment or holds a multistate RN license through the interstate Nurse Licensure Compact required.

AHA BLS prior to end of orientation period

PREFERRED QUALIFICATION(S):

  • Nursing Professional Development Certification or specialty certification

WHY PENN STATE HEALTH HOLY SPIRIT MEDICAL CENTER?

Penn State Health Holy Spirit Medical Center brings acute inpatient medical services to the greater Harrisburg region with outpatient and inpatient locations in Cumberland, Dauphin, Perry, and Northern York counties. The facility features 281 beds, a four-story Ortenzio Heart Center, and around-the-clock complex critical care for those suffering from life-threatening injuries.
